Dimitrov recalls: I was so excited.

Rafael Nadal and professional tennis will soon be over.

At the Davis Cup finals in Malaga in November, the Prince of Manacor will be putting an end to his career for good.

To realize the golden page in tennis history that is about to be turned, it's worth listening to what Rafa's colleagues have to say.

For example, we can recall what Grigor Dimitrov said in 2009 when asked about his first face-to-face meeting with Nadal.

The two men first crossed swords in Rotterdam in 2009.

At the time, the Spaniard was world number 1 and the Bulgarian only 478th and invited by the organizers.

However, the match was very close, with the Majorquin winning in 3 fine sets (7-5, 3-6, 6-2).

Speaking to We Love Tennis, he recalls: "The first thing I thought was: 'Wow, I've really done that!

I went out on court, fought Rafa and it lasted two and a half hours!'

I was so excited that I couldn't sleep the night after the match.

In all honesty, I didn't expect to play such a good match."
